Travelling From Shirdi To Bangalore

Bangalore, the most vivacious cosmopolitan city, is located in the Indian state of Karnataka in the southern part of the country. The weather of the city is always mild around the year. This has encouraged a number of international and other firms to begin their new business ventures in Bangalore. This city is officially called as Bengaluru. Bangalore is known for its excellent transport system. The buses operated by Bangalore Metropolitan Transport Corporation (BMTC) are available in the city always.

Bangalore has numerous parks, palaces, gardens and temples. Ulsoor Lake is a lovely lake in the city to unwind and for boat ride. Constructed in 1887, the Bangalore Palace was the seat of the rulers in the city. Lal Bagh is a prominent botanical garden established during the rein of Tipu Sultan. This garden is home to a great collection of tropical plants and is a favorite destination of students and visitors. Bull Temple of 16th century is also a famous tourist center. Bangalore has a number of malls, pubs, cinema halls and other advanced amenities.

Bangalore provide a wonderful glee to shopaholics and the prominent shopping destinations in the city are Commercial Street and M. G. Road from where you can purchase ethnic ornaments, silk, dress materials, fragrant sandalwood and Mysore saris.

Shirdi is a devotional centre located in the district of Ahmednagar in the Indian state of Maharashtra. It is the busiest town in the state. This town was the home of the renowned 20th century saint, Sai Baba. He came to this village when he was 16 and lived here for several years. Sai Baba is regarded as the avatar of Lord Shiva. This spiritual town rejuvenates and revives our body and soul. Pilgrims visit here for the darshan in the Samadhi Mandir. It is where the corporeal remain of Sai Baba is interred. A masjid is also seen close to the place where Sai Baba used to spend most of his days.
Travelling From Shirdi To Bangalore


The city of Shirdi has no airport. The nearby airport that has direct flight to Bangalore is Mumbai. Train is the perfect mode of transport to cover this distance. Many trains are available from Shirdi to Bangalore. The trains from Shirdi arrive at any of the three stations in Bangalore namely Bangalore city Junction, Bangalore Cantonment and Yeshvantpur Junction. Yesvantpur Garibrath connects Shirdi to Bangalore. Numerous trains from Shirdi arrive at Manmad, which is located at a distance of 40 km away from Shirdi. Adi Sbc Express and Karnataka Express connect Bangalore with Manmad.

The distance between Shirdi to Bangalore is 1021 km by road. It will take about 15 hours to reach Bangalore in your car. Though the distance is large, people do drive down from Bangalore.
